Mission & Purpose

Nielsen is a global measurement and data analytics company that provides insights and intelligence to businesses in various industries. They specialise in collecting and analysing data related to consumer behaviour, media consumption, and market trends. Nielsen's ultimate mission is to provide clients with a comprehensive understanding of consumer preferences and market dynamics to drive informed decision-making. Their purpose is to help businesses navigate the rapidly changing marketplace by offering data-driven insights that optimise marketing strategies, improve product development, and drive business growth. Nielsen aims to be a trusted source of accurate and actionable data, empowering their clients to adapt to market shifts, identify growth opportunities, and build strong connections with their target audience. By leveraging their expertise in data analytics, Nielsen supports businesses in making data-backed decisions that lead to competitive advantage and sustainable success.
